Transaction 4489567c7f32aa61b1414ed0923565b8d7def0e1c072f7a2d3d34eb4fc084988

1 Input
2 Outputs
  • 4489567c7f32aa61b1414ed0923565b8d7def0e1c072f7a2d3d34eb4fc084988:0
  • value  16891519
    address  bc1q8afqhdyswr28vz9xxmw723zrzapzdyxlsutfyh
  • 4489567c7f32aa61b1414ed0923565b8d7def0e1c072f7a2d3d34eb4fc084988:1
  • value  1478110
    address  36kmmDP6TAypdnd1G5z4dDKkYs7w7vy2aT